Runbook fragment — clock skew on Forgeline build agents. If builds start failing signature checks or artifacts land with timestamps from the future, odds are an agent's clock drifted. Check skew against the Driftwatch panel; anything over two seconds means pull the agent and resync. When you file the drift report, include the agent's last good build token, shown below.

session token of bawep-yadup = htk21_528abd376e3c5a4ec24a1

- [ ] **Step 7: Breaker override escrow.** After sealing the signing keys for the Tallgrove upstream API circuit breaker, confirm the support team can force the breaker open during a full outage. The override bundle lives in the sealed escrow drawer and is useless without its unlock phrase. Two ceremony witnesses must initial this step before proceeding. The escrow bundle is decrypted with the recovery passphrase that follows.

vault phrase of kahip-kahop = holath-quenmir

STAGEVIEW RENDERER — plugin notes. Your plugin draws overlays after the base seat grid loads, so hook onGridReady, not onMount. Balcony sections at the Pellworth Playhouse use curved rows; call the arc helper or seats will misalign. Pricing tints come from the internal tier service, which needs auth on every request. Drop the key below into your plugin config.

API key for yahig-tadup: kto7_ubizbYm

Minutes — Management Meeting

Prepared for the incoming director. Topic: possible acquisition of Greyfen Analytics. Due diligence 70% complete. Valuation gap remains; Greyfen seeks a premium. Integration risks flagged by Ops. Decision deferred to next month. Talla Nyberg leads negotiations. Our walk-away position is stated below.

board note of fawig-kagup: Only 48 of the 435 pilot accounts renewed Rusion, so a churn review is set for September 12. Fenwynox Logistics is in early talks to buy Sorielek Systems for about $117.8 million.

Welcome aboard. This Friday we run the disaster-recovery drill for the Canewick internal API gateway. During the drill, rate limits on the east cluster will be deliberately halved, so expect 429s on the batch endpoints — that's intentional, please don't page anyone. Your role is to verify the limiter fails open when the config store is unreachable, and to document recovery timing. To access the standby limiter console during the exercise, you'll need the recovery passphrase noted below.

unlock words, yawig-kagef: gordor-holvan-ulaael-pramir-ulaiel-tamdor